BACHELOR
OF SCIENCE - COMPUTER SCIENCE
College-wide Requirements:
In addition to meeting the requirement in General Education and in the
major, students
must also complete six (6) credits in the Liberal Arts Core required
of all majors in the College of Arts and Sciences. Options for satisfying
this requirements are outlined under the section on the College of
Arts and Sciences. Also, in order to qualify for gradation, students
must pass the Senior Departmental comprehensive Examination; must have
taken all of their junior - and senior-level requirements in the major
at Morgan (unless granted prior written permission by the Dean to take
courses elsewhere); and must have earned a cumulative average of 2.0
or better and a major average of 2.0 or better, with no outstanding
grades below "C" in the major (which includes all courses
required for the major and required supporting courses).
MASTER
OF SCIENCE - BIOINFORMATICS
The
required curriculum for completion of the program consists of a total
of 38 credits: 12 credit hours from
the Bioinformatics Core Courses;
12 credit hours of Computer Science, Mathematics and Statistics Core
Courses; 6 credit hours of Elective Courses from Bioinformatics, Biology,
Chemistry,
Computer Science, Mathematics, Statistics, Physics, and other appropriate
disciplines; 2 credit hours of Seminar in Bioinformatics; and, 6 credit
hours of Thesis Research in Bioinformatics. The cross-disciplinary nature
of the curriculum offers great flexibility based on the student’s
personal scientific interests and background, through the broad range
of course offerings available.
